What a home in Garden City sells for, and how long it takes

What the recorded deeds say, how long a sale takes where OneKey® MLS measures it, and what a seller pays at closing. Every figure on this page names its source.

Recorded deeds put the median sale in Garden City at $1,366,250, across 120 arm's-length sales in the rolling 12 months ended September 2, 2026, and OneKey® MLS measures a typical 17 days from listing to contract.

What a Seller Pays at Closing in Garden City
New York State transfer tax
0.4%$2 for every $500 of the sale price

Rates as of September 2026; your attorney confirms the figures at contract.

The Buyer You Are Selling To

A buyer in Garden City is not subject to the pied-à-terre surcharge that applies in New York City or the Peconic Bay transfer taxes that apply on the East End. Financing, timing and how the property is positioned matter more here than any added tax at the closing table.
